Cotswold Boat Hire offers boat rentals ranging from one hour to a full day as well as weekend breaks and longer boating holidays.
The firm operates from Buscot Lock near Lechlade - SN7 8DA - and its fleet is predominantly powered by modern electric engines, providing a quiet and environmentally friendly way to explore the River Thames.
A spokesperson said: "Just a short drive from Swindon, Cotswold Boat Hire is a hidden gem located at Buscot Lock.
"With convenient parking and a wide range of boats available, visitors can enjoy anything from a leisurely one-hour cruise to a multi-day adventure on the water.
"No previous boating experience is required, and both children and dogs are welcome aboard."
